Driftwood is our orphaned-resource sweeper. It scans each environment hourly for volumes, snapshots, and load balancers with no owning stack tag, then deletes them after a grace window.

Three environments: sandbox (aggressive, 2h grace), staging (24h), prod (7 days plus manual approval). New team members: never lower the prod grace window without sign-off from the platform lead.

Dry-run mode is on by default in sandbox only. Logs go to the shared sweeper dashboard.

The active configuration for each environment is listed below.

service settings:
ulaael:
  log_level: debug
  metrics_host: metrics.ulaael.zemvarsys.internal
  pin: 7155
  pool_size: 32

The Murmurline audio waveform preview service renders peaks from uploaded media in an isolated worker pool. Normal operators cannot reach the render hosts directly; this is intentional, since decoded audio buffers may contain sensitive material. Break-glass access exists solely for incidents where the peak cache corrupts and previews fail fleet-wide. Each use is logged, time-boxed to one hour, and reviewed by the security team afterward. To open the break-glass session on the Harrowgate bastion, supply the recovery passphrase below.

vault phrase of tajef-tafog = istox-sorax-zorox-casok-holox-kelix-weneth-drueth-casion

## Runbook: Connection Pool Changes

Plugin authors integrating with the Ostermill data layer: release 7.1 caps per-plugin pool size at twelve connections and enforces a two-second acquisition timeout. Audit your plugins for long-held connections and release them promptly, or requests will queue and time out. After updating, run the pool stress check in the sandbox. Signed plugin packages only — sign your archive with the key below.

release key, fafof-hawip: bky6_52YEwQ